Gravel biking around Castelmaurou offers diverse experiences across varied landscapes, making it an appealing destination for outdoor enthusiasts. The region is characterized by a preserved green environment, including a significant 44-hectare forest and routes extending into the Girou valley. Cyclists can explore a mix of woodlands, open spaces, and agricultural lands, providing a natural immersion away from urban areas. This varied terrain supports a range of no traffic gravel bike trails suitable for different skill levels.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many no-traffic gravel bike trails are available around Castelmaurou?

There are nearly 30 dedicated no-traffic gravel bike trails around Castelmaurou, offering a wide range of experiences. These routes are designed to keep you away from vehicular traffic, providing a peaceful and immersive cycling experience.

What is the best time of year to go gravel biking in Castelmaurou?

The region around Castelmaurou offers pleasant conditions for gravel biking for much of the year. Spring and autumn generally provide the most comfortable temperatures and beautiful scenery. While winter can be an option for car-free routes, always check local weather conditions, as some trails might be affected by rain or colder temperatures.

Are there any easy, no-traffic gravel routes suitable for beginners in Castelmaurou?

Yes, while many routes are moderate to difficult, there are options for beginners. For example, the area features routes that incorporate mostly paved surfaces with gravel sections, allowing for a gentler introduction to gravel biking. Look for routes with lower elevation gains and shorter distances if you're just starting out.

What kind of terrain can I expect on the no-traffic gravel trails around Castelmaurou?

The gravel trails around Castelmaurou offer varied terrain. You can expect to ride through preserved green environments, extensive woodlands like the 44-hectare forest near Natura Game, and potentially agricultural lands characteristic of the Midi-Pyrénées region. Some routes also follow river valleys, such as the Girou, providing diverse landscapes.

Are there any family-friendly no-traffic gravel bike trails in Castelmaurou?

Yes, Castelmaurou's natural setting, particularly its preserved green spaces and woodlands, lends itself to family-friendly cycling. While specific routes vary, many of the no-traffic options are suitable for families looking for a safe and enjoyable ride away from cars. Consider routes that are shorter in distance and have less elevation gain.

Can I bring my dog on the gravel bike trails in Castelmaurou?

Many natural areas and trails around Castelmaurou are dog-friendly, especially if your dog is accustomed to running alongside a bike or can be carried safely. However, it's always best to check specific trail regulations or local signage, especially in protected natural environments, and ensure your dog is under control.

What interesting landmarks or attractions can I see along the gravel bike routes?

While cycling the no-traffic gravel routes, you might encounter various points of interest. The region is rich in natural beauty, including the extensive forest that hosts Natura Game. Further afield, you can explore historical sites and monuments in nearby Toulouse, such as the Capitole Square, The Capitole of Toulouse, and the Saint-Sernin Basilica.

Where can I find parking for gravel biking near Castelmaurou?

Parking is generally available in and around Castelmaurou, especially near trailheads or local amenities. For routes starting from specific locations, such as those near Borderouge or Argoulets, you'll typically find designated parking areas. Always check the starting point of your chosen route for the most convenient parking options.

Are there any challenging no-traffic gravel routes for experienced riders?

Absolutely. For experienced gravel bikers seeking a challenge, routes like the Forest around the lake – Montjoire Hill loop from Argoulets offer significant distances (over 90 km) and considerable elevation gains (over 900m), requiring good fitness. Another demanding option is the Roller coasters – Forest around the lake loop from Borderouge, which features over 600m of elevation gain.

What do other gravel bikers say about the no-traffic trails in Castelmaurou?

The komoot community highly rates the cycling experiences around Castelmaurou, with an average score of 4.57 stars. Riders often praise the diverse landscapes, the peacefulness of the car-free routes, and the opportunity to explore both natural environments and charming local areas away from urban traffic.

Are there any loop routes available for gravel biking in Castelmaurou?

Yes, many of the no-traffic gravel routes around Castelmaurou are designed as loops, allowing you to start and finish at the same point. Examples include the challenging Forest around the lake – Montjoire Hill loop from Argoulets and the moderate Buzet Mountain Bike — Long Route – Buzet loop from Bartas Nègre.

Can I find cafes or restaurants along the no-traffic gravel routes?

While the no-traffic routes prioritize natural immersion, many trails pass through or near small towns and villages where you can find local cafes, bakeries, or restaurants. It's always a good idea to plan your route and check for amenities in advance, especially for longer rides, to ensure you have refreshment stops.

Is public transport an option for reaching the gravel trails with my bike?

Castelmaurou is situated near Toulouse, which has a well-developed public transport network. Depending on the specific starting point of your chosen trail, you may be able to use regional buses or trains that accommodate bicycles. It's advisable to check the public transport provider's website for their bike carriage policies and schedules before planning your trip.
